What does the traffic violation code 1345 for motor vehicles crossing prohibited markings mean?
1 Answers
Motor vehicle violation of prohibited marking 1345 means that the vehicle has violated the instructions of prohibited markings, including driving over double yellow lines, parking in areas marked with no-parking lines, etc. Below is relevant information about traffic violation codes: Meaning of violation codes: Traffic violation codes consist of four to five digits, categorized according to the principles in traffic laws. The sequence from left to right represents: one digit for behavior classification code, one digit for penalty point classification code, and two digits for sequential code. Methods for violation inquiry: Vehicle owners can check specific traffic violations through the traffic violation code table, or inquire about violation information via 12123, terminal machines at traffic police station halls, or online platforms.
